Corn fritters cyberealm

6 Servings

Ingredients

Quantity Ingredient
½ cup All-purpose flour
½ teaspoon Baking powder.
½ teaspoon Salt
1 cup Corn kernels
1 Egg
2 tablespoons Butter or margarine
1 tablespoon Milk
Oil for frying pan

Directions

1. Place dry ingredients, corn, melted butter or margarine, milk, well-beaten egg into the food processor and pulse about a half dozen times until it's well mixed and the corn kernels are somewhat broken up. (You don't want mush). 2. Deep fry (drop off a tablespoon into the hot oil) in peanut oil at high setting (400-425 degrees) until deep golden brown. (Be careful not to burn.) 3. Remove, drain on paper towels and serve with breakfast sausage, and maple syrup.

They're good all day, Good for Barbecues or with things like catfish or fried chicken. but really taste best when very fresh, so it's best to time it so the come out of the oil shortly before serving time. You can make batter ahead of time -- or make extra if you're going to have a buffet. Then when they disappear, just make another bunch.
